This print from the Liszt Collection takes us back to the year 1908 in Meiszen, Germany. The focal point of the image is none other than the majestic Albrechtsburg, standing tall and proud against a picturesque backdrop. This historic castle, with its stunning architecture and rich history, has long been an iconic symbol of Saxony. However, what truly adds intrigue to this photograph are the paddle steamers and unidentified steamships that grace the river below. These vessels seem to be engaged in their daily activities, navigating through the calm waters with purposeful determination. Their presence not only showcases the importance of water transportation during that era but also provides a glimpse into how people traveled and traded goods along these rivers.
